Specialists consider many different parameters – these are the type of panels, amperage, and voltage, as well as the house’s location, the lighting intensity, …Circuits consisting of just one battery and one load resistance are very simple to analyze, but they are not often found in practical applications. Usually, we find circuits where more than two components are connected together. There are two fundamental ways in which to connect more than two circuit components: series and parallel.These two basic …Calculating Parallel Resistances. In a parallel circuit, two or more resistors share the same voltage source but have separate paths for current to flow. Unlike series resistances, where the total resistance is simply the sum of individual resistors, parallel resistors follow a different rule. In parallel, the total resistance R total is always ...

For a more …Configuration of batteries in series and in parallel : calculate global energy stored (capacity) according to voltage and AH value of each cell. To get the voltage of batteries in series you have to sum the voltage of each cell in the serie. To get the current in output of several batteries in parallel you have to sum the current of each branch .

For instance, if the above circuit were simple series, we could just add up R 1 through R 4 to arrive at a total ...Parallel operation is the fact to put in operation 2 pumps besides each other on 2 parallel pipes that are merging after the pumps. It allows to add the pump capacities. Series operation is the fact to put in operation 2 pumps one after the other on a single circuit. It allows to add the pump heads.
